The short version

Install the full VOC OpenAPI MCP server for Amazon review insights, feedback tagging, listing optimization, and hundreds of published data tools in local AI clients.

  • Fetch current or historical Amazon reviews
  • Analyze sentiment, pain points, and themes
  • Generate listing improvements from customer feedback
  • Tag feedback and product listings into structured taxonomies

What it needs from you

Configuration is passed through the environment: VOC_OPENAPI_API_KEY, VOC_API_KEY, X_API_KEY. Treat anything key-shaped as a real credential — scope it to the minimum the server needs, and rotate it if it ever lands in a shared config.

Things to watch

  • Your data travels to the provider's service, so the usual questions apply about what you send and what they retain.
  • Missing credentials fail quietly in some clients — if no tools show up, check the environment block first.
  • Keep per-call confirmation enabled while you learn its behaviour; it is the cheapest safeguard you have.

How to install the Voc MCP server

{
  "mcpServers": {
    "openapi-1": {
      "command": "npx",
      "args": ["-y", "voc-openapi-mcp"],
      "env": {
        "VOC_OPENAPI_API_KEY": "your-value",
        "VOC_API_KEY": "your-value",
        "X_API_KEY": "your-value"
      }
    }
  }
}

Add to claude_desktop_config.json, then restart Claude Desktop.
